Description:

After her mother dies, Astrid moves to the small Oregon coastal town of Hook Bay to live with her grandfather, Steve Barton. She has to cope with life in a new environment with old friends’ help and betrayal, a new school to attend for her senior year and an early encounter with the forces of nature. Steve’s love and guidance, as well as Astrid’s ability as an artist helps her through difficult times. New friends enter her life, old ones return and her talent is encouraged by the local school principal. Her life now has a future. That is until the tsunami builds up in the northern Pacific Ocean and heads east... Directly towards Hook Bay.
